ABOUT US

Celltrion Healthcare provides biosimilar and innovative biopharmaceutical medications to help increase patient access to advanced therapies around the world.

Celltrion Healthcare offers biologics to about 110 countries, along with more than 30 global partners around the world. With hands-on experience and knowledge accumulated through years of working in the advanced pharmaceutical markets around the world, Celltrion Healthcare has been securing distribution channels and providing patients with biosimilars at affordable prices.

POSITION SUMMARY

The Key Account Manager (KAM) is an important, externally focused position, within the newly formed entity of Celltrion Healthcare in Canada (CHC). The KAM will have an assigned sales territory and be responsible for achieving sales targets for the company’s clinical immunology and allergy portfolio, based on key account planning and strategic execution. The portfolio includes already launched, as well as soon to launch medicines. As a KAM, you bring to the company a deep understanding of the management of allergy and dermatology disorders using biologics, and have a strong network within the territory that is assigned. This role will require close collaboration with Marketing, Medical, Sales, Patient Support and Market Access, as well with other KAMs.
